As a Clinic Director at Ellie Mental Health, you'll share our vision for improving and expanding access to quality mental health care and thrive in an environment driven by our core values of authenticity, humor, compassion, creativity, acceptance, and determination.
The Clinic Director will be highly compensated (salary, commissions, and bonuses!) for accepting responsibility for the overall performance and operation of a clinic composed of approximately 10- 15 professional outpatient therapists. This includes hiring and recruiting fantastic, unique, and fun-loving clinicians; managing clinic performance and client satisfaction; providing training and ongoing developmental support; meeting fiscal goals; marketing clinical services and building community partnerships and referrals. You will also maintain a reasonable client caseload.
Ellie Mental Health was founded in 2015 by Erin Pash, LMFT, and Kyle Keller, LICSW when they opened the first Ellie clinic in Minneapolis. Since then, the Ellie Fam has continued to grow with multiple clinics in Minnesota and a growing number of locally owned and operated franchises across the country.
Ellie was proudly founded on the principle of destigmatizing mental health. The mental health industry is full of barriers, and weve made it our goal to fill the gap and find innovative ways to break down these barriers for the communities we serve.

Reporting & Supervision

  • Clinic Director reports to local Franchise Owner.
  • All clinic therapists report to Clinic Director.
Responsibilities include:


Hiring, Training, and Staff Management

  • Oversee the hiring process for all therapists at their clinic.
  • Provide all training for clinic new hires, ensuring all required Ellie Mental Health clinical and operational policies and procedures are taught and followed.
  • Assess ongoing development and training needs and conduct ongoing training as needed.
  • Hold staff compassionately accountable for meeting performance expectations.
  • Manage staff performance, including implementing Performance Coaching, Performance Improvement Plans, and termination process as needed.

Supervision and Consultation

  • Oversee peer consultation groups to ensure clinical excellence and align with best practices
  • Provide clinical oversight to clinics Mental Health Practitioners and Professionals, including signing clinical documentation for pre-licensed providers.
  • Participate in Clinic Director Peer Consult Group.
  • Provide 1:1 consultation with all therapy staff to review productivity, caseload, and clinical documentation
Client Care

  • Evaluate mental health diagnosis, create, and implement a treatment plan, complete ongoing documentation including further diagnosis, treatment plan reviews, and case notes according to company policy
  • Utilize creativity in interventions to help clients achieve and exceed goals
  • Prepare and submit individual documentation for each session per company guidelines and protocol
  • Coordinate services with case managers, families, work personnel, medical personnel, other Ellie staff, and school staff as needed
Clinic Oversight

  • Collaborate with franchise owner and Ellie Mental Health corporate staff (as needed) to implement strategies for fiscal and clinical efficiency.
  • Monitor and manage clinic office schedules and office supplies.
  • Provide timely response to concerns raised by clients, clinicians, or external stakeholders.
  • Serve as point of contact for building management related issues or concerns.
Clinic Outreach, Marketing, and Networking

  • Spearhead clinics community outreach and engagement efforts, in collaboration with franchise owner and consistent with guidance from Ellie Outreach Team.
  • Collaborate with Ellie Marketing Team to promote clinics online visibility.
Organizational Leadership

  • Collaborate with franchise owner and Ellie Corporate Team to implement all required policies and procedures.
  • Identify opportunities to improve client care, quality, and effectiveness, and implement changes in collaboration with franchise owner.
Required Skills/Abilities

  • Masters Degree or higher education in mental health discipline.
  • Independently licensed with a New Jersey-issued clinical practice license (e.g., LCSW, LMFT, LPC).
  • Board Approved Supervisor certification (or willingness to obtain).
  • Strong leadership, problem-solving, and executive skill sets.
  • Strong working knowledge of state requirements regulating mental health practice.
  • Excellent verbal and written communication skills; excellent interpersonal and customer service skills; Excellent organizational skills and attention to detail.
  • Working understanding of human resource principles, practices, and procedures.
  • Excellent time management skills with a proven ability to meet deadlines.
  • Ability to function well in a high-paced and changing environment.
  • Proficient with Microsoft 365 applications.
  • Adept at learning and navigating Electronic Health Record systems.
